Copyright © 2025 chelsea.yabsta.co.uk All Right Reserved
powered by
5-7 Clarence Rd. Greater London, United Kingdom, N22 8PG
Flat 68, Malcolmson House, Aylesford St. Westminster Abbey, London, United Kingdom, SW1V 3RR
200-202 Cambridge Rd. Kingston upon Thames, Greater London, United Kingdom, KT1 3LF
16 Progress Way Croydon, Greater London, United Kingdom, CR0 4XD
59A Lind Rd. Sutton, Greater London, United Kingdom, SM1 4PP
Unit 1, Tait Rd. Croydon, Greater London, United Kingdom, CR0 2DP
14 Prk. Rd. Kingston upon Thames, Greater London, United Kingdom, KT2 6BG
207-211 Coventry Rd. Bethnal Green, London, United Kingdom, E2 6JN
Rear Of 353 Eastern Ave. Greater London, United Kingdom, IG2 6NE
366 Station Rd., Wanstead Prk. Newham, London, United Kingdom, E7 0AB